A view of Rome

Day trip from Colleferro to Rome

Why visit Rome for the day?

Rome is Italy's capital, known for ancient ruins, monumental churches, and busy piazzas. Daily life unfolds among layers of history, giving the city a grand yet lived-in character.

A view of Frosinone

Day trip from Colleferro to Frosinone

Why visit Frosinone for the day?

Frosinone is the provincial capital of southern Lazio, known for its hilltop old quarter and broad views over the Sacco Valley. More civic and local than monumental, it offers a feel for everyday central Italian life with deep Roman-era roots.

A view of Anagni

Day trip from Colleferro to Anagni

Why visit Anagni for the day?

Anagni is a historic hill town in Lazio known as the City of Popes. Its medieval streets and frescoed cathedral give it a calm, deeply historic character.

A view of Cassino

Day trip from Colleferro to Cassino

Why visit Cassino for the day?

Cassino is known for Montecassino Abbey and the World War II history tied to the city and its hills. Rebuilt after the war, it feels modern yet reflective, with a university presence and a setting between the Liri Valley and the mountains.

A view of Naples

Day trip from Colleferro to Naples

Why visit Naples for the day?

Naples is a lively southern Italian city known for its historic center and the pizza tradition born here. Its crowded streets, baroque churches, and Bay of Naples setting give it an intense, layered character.
